| direct acrylic restoration | A direct resin restoration of autopolymerizing acrylic. (05 Mar 2000) |

| direct composite resin restoration | A direct restoration made by inserting a plastic mix of auto or light-polymerised resins in a cavity prepared in a tooth. Synonym: direct composite resin restoration. (05 Mar 2000) |
| direct resin restoration | A direct restoration made by inserting a plastic mix of auto or light-polymerised resins in a cavity prepared in a tooth. Synonym: direct composite resin restoration. (05 Mar 2000) |
| overhanging restoration | A restoration with excessive material at the junction of the restoration margin and the tooth. (05 Mar 2000) |
| temporary restoration | A restoration to be used for a limited period of time, in contradistinction to a permanent restoration. (05 Mar 2000) |
| ecological restoration | <ecology> The process of renewing and maintaining ecosystem health. Ecological restoration is the process of intentionally altering a site to establish a defined, indigenous, historic ecosystem. The goal of this process is to emulate the structure, function, diversity, and dynamics of the specified ecosystem. (10 Nov 1998) |
